Keefe, Bruyette & Woods Issues Positive Forecast for RenaissanceRe (NYSE:RNR) Stock Price

RenaissanceRe logo with Finance background

RenaissanceRe (NYSE:RNR - Get Free Report) had its price objective hoisted by research analysts at Keefe, Bruyette & Woods from $279.00 to $282.00 in a research report issued on Tuesday,Benzinga reports. The brokerage presently has an "outperform" rating on the insurance provider's stock. Keefe, Bruyette & Woods' price objective points to a potential upside of 16.47% from the company's current price.

Other equities analysts also recently issued reports about the stock. Jefferies Financial Group cut their price target on shares of RenaissanceRe from $266.00 to $265.00 and set a "hold" rating for the company in a report on Friday, April 11th. JMP Securities reissued a "market perform" rating on shares of RenaissanceRe in a report on Thursday, April 24th. Wells Fargo & Company dropped their target price on shares of RenaissanceRe from $277.00 to $271.00 and set an "overweight" rating for the company in a research note on Thursday, April 10th. JPMorgan Chase & Co. raised shares of RenaissanceRe from a "neutral" rating to an "overweight" rating and set a $284.00 target price for the company in a research note on Tuesday, April 8th. Finally, Morgan Stanley raised shares of RenaissanceRe from an "equal weight" rating to an "overweight" rating and boosted their target price for the stock from $235.00 to $275.00 in a research note on Friday. Two equities research analysts have rated the stock with a sell rating, four have assigned a hold rating and six have given a buy rating to the company. According to MarketBeat, the stock currently has an average rating of "Hold" and a consensus price target of $282.60.

RenaissanceRe Stock Performance

NYSE RNR traded up $4.24 during midday trading on Tuesday, hitting $242.13. The company had a trading volume of 165,935 shares, compared to its average volume of 539,060. The company has a quick ratio of 1.42, a current ratio of 1.42 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.19. The stock has a market cap of $11.87 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 6.91, a P/E/G ratio of 2.09 and a beta of 0.29. The firm has a fifty day simple moving average of $237.81 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$251.74. RenaissanceRe has a fifty-two week low of $208.98 and a fifty-two week high of $300.00.

RenaissanceRe (NYSE:RNR - Get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Wednesday, April 23rd. The insurance provider reported ($1.49) ear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of ($0.32) by ($1.17). RenaissanceRe had a net margin of 15.99% and a return on equity of 23.41%. The business had revenue of $3.44 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$3.36 billion. During the same quarter last year, the firm posted $12.18 earnings per share. RenaissanceRe's revenue was up 7.6% on a year-over-year basis. Equities analysts forecast that RenaissanceRe will post 26.04 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

RenaissanceRe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

RenaissanceRe Holdings Ltd., together with its subsidiaries, provides reinsurance and insurance products in the United States and internationally. The company operates through Property, and Casualty and Specialty segments. The Property segment writes property catastrophe excess of loss reinsurance and excess of loss reinsurance to insure insurance and reinsurance companies against natural and man-made catastrophes, including hurricanes, earthquakes, typhoons, and tsunamis, as well as winter storms, freezes, floods, fires, windstorms, tornadoes, explosions, and acts of terrorism; and other property class of products, such as proportional reinsurance, property per risk, property reinsurance, binding facilities, and regional U.S.
